Tickets for one of the highlights of this year’s MassKara Festival are already sold out, Bacolod Yuhum Foundation Secretary and Festival Director for Cultural and Accredited Events, Kuster Cadagat confirmed yesterday, a press release from BYF said.
The BYF invited the public earlier last week to take part in the MassKarade Ball 2024: Sapphirus as part of the 45th Sapphire celebration of the world-renowned festival.
Cadagat said that they expected for the tickets to sell fast since they were limited, and anticipated the influx of calls for reservations following their announcement.
“We were overwhelmed by those who want to experience the MassKarade Ball. It was well received last year; we had a number of personalities who joined the glamorous event, and we promise to top that experience this year,” Cadagat added.
The MassKarade Ball 2024: Sapphirus is scheduled on October 25, 6:45 p.m. at the Saffron Hall of Roy’s Hotel.
The organizers promise a night of glitz and glamor, as well as a palette adventure featuring iconic dishes that reflect the culinary heritage of Bacolod City.*
